Searching the boards I found answers for Windows users but not us fine Mac folk. Usually I can find them using the windows location as a guide but that hasn't been the case with my SMPW and before I start customizing this thing I need to make sure I can find the config files and back them up.

3Dconnexion really should have a user friendly way to do this via the app.

jesse.art wrote: Mon Feb 01, 2021 4:41 am 3Dconnexion really should have a user friendly way to do this via the app.
Go to the "3Dconnexion" pane in the System Preferences, click the pull-down menu and check if the "Export Configuration..." feature is what you're looking for. Make sure you verify if the feature works for you.

The "configuration" data is saved to ~/Library/Preferences/com.3dconnexion.mappings.plist
